We picked up our first free couch in 2017.
It all started from a desire to become a debt-free family of seven. We wanted to learn to live on cold hard cash money. Things got tightΒ and we got tough - and the ever more resourceful we became.

When we drove by the couch in an Leawood, KS neighborhood, we found ourselves at a dead stop. A misshapen cushion and 'lil bit dirty, but she had potential.

We cringed, put on our gloves, and threw her on our back. We took her to our garage, cleaned and steamed, and then listed her for sale.

That sofa turned out to be FOUR hundred dollar bills that had a "FREE" sign scribbled on it. We high-fived each other and went and did it again. And again. And again.

We started our couch journey during our home flipping career in Kansas City, KS.

We had to do these flips with our own cash, without debtΒ (we literally have zero credit cards) all while raising a family and living inside them. Our kids are very cool, and they will remember it forever. Even if that means they will never renovate homes themselves. Ever.

Without childcare (too expensive) and in the midst of a pandemic in early 2020 (in a city where we knew nobody), we demolished the floor right beneath us. We funded our home flips and purchased the supplies we needed with couch money.Β 

We would renovate during the day- doing all the work ourselves- when our kids were awake and then at night we would quietly list and sell couches.
It was a secret to all who knew us back home. We weren't sure how to explain that we were flipping used sofas.Β 

We rented our first little storage unit in late 2020 and by three months later we rented the entire storage facility.

Our oldest son earned a drivers license and was given tie downs to work with in about the same day. We'd go as far to say he's moved more sofas across this country than most major manufacturers, all by himself.

In mid-2021 we moved back to where we call home, Marshfield, MO.

We noticed two things:
1. New sofas were expensive.
2. The market of sofas could use a little help. A little of our help.

The business took off again.

A longtime favorite restaurant building became available in our little town. We had eaten here as a family for many years, and now it sat empty. We called our friend who owned the building, and struck a deal.

This became our first "brick and mortar" store. The days in that little store were long. We were there for the delivery truck at 7am, waved at the mailman at noon, greeted our 2nd shifters at 5pm, put our kids to sleep on couches at 8pm, and went home somewhere between 2-4am (if we got to go home instead of crashing on a couch..)

When not at the store, we spent all-nighters and weekend-long journeys all over the midwest delivering and finding the most beautiful sofas. We figured out how to comfortably sleep in the back of a cargo trailer while on the road.


We started to realize we had created something amazing and the need for it was even bigger than we could ever have imagined. We initially carried fabric pieces, but our true calling came on a family trip to Texas.

On that trip we made the decision to exclusively carry qualityΒ leather.


We fell in love with leather working.

We equally learned and worked hard together.

Leather was our passion.

Our little store began to take shape, and we became known for the highest quality leather pieces in the United States, at half of the new retail prices.

We learned how to dye, custom upholstery, repair, paint, and embellish the most beautiful custom pieces you'll find anywhere.

We custom upholster pieces with hair-on-hides, along with a vast collection of embossed hides, alligator, lizard, snake, crocodile, and stingray.
